Course Description
This course introduces students to two-dimensional elements and principles of graphic design as the basis of visual language and communication. Through problem solving approach, students manipulate graphic forms and design elements in black-and-white and color media to convey meaning, strategies for idea generation and development of distinctive concepts. Emphasis is given to the importance of presentation and craftsmanship.
